MCPcopy Index your code
hub / github.com/pyload/pyload / grab_info

Method grab_info

module/plugins/internal/Base.py:222–233  ·  view source on GitHub ↗
(self)

Source from the content-addressed store, hash-verified

220 self._update_status()
221
222 def grab_info(self):
223 self.log_info(_("Grabbing link info..."))
224
225 old_info = dict(self.info)
226 new_info = self.get_info(self.pyfile.url, self.data)
227
228 self.info.update(new_info)
229
230 self.log_debug("Link info: %s" % self.info)
231 self.log_debug("Previous link info: %s" % old_info)
232
233 self.sync_info()
234
235 def check_status(self):
236 status = self.pyfile.status

Callers 3

_setupMethod · 0.95
processMethod · 0.45
get_fileInfoMethod · 0.45

Calls 7

get_infoMethod · 0.95
sync_infoMethod · 0.95
dictFunction · 0.85
log_infoMethod · 0.80
log_debugMethod · 0.80
_Function · 0.50
updateMethod · 0.45

Tested by

no test coverage detected